National Driver Offender Retraining Scheme (NDORS) Self-Employed Theory Trainer Opportunity

Moorgate Training are a leading training provider who deliver approved driver safety training courses throughout the UK. We are looking to expand our panel of trainers and welcome applications who are appropriately qualified, experienced and are enthusiastic.

We are currently recruiting trainers to deliver our National Driver Offender Retraining Scheme (NDORS) National Speed Awareness Course online. The course delivery format would be online via Zoom.

If you want the flexibility to work at a time and frequency that suits you, we have the availability to work with you on a freelance / self-employed basis.

What we’re looking for :

We ask that all trainers delivering the NDORS courses on our behalf must hold the following qualifications and experience as a minimum requirement :

  • Licenced by UK Road Offender Education (UKROEd) to deliver National Driver Offender Retraining Scheme (NDORS) course(s)
  • A nationally recognised teaching qualification at level 3 or above in delivering teaching or training.
  • Hold a current Disclosure and Barring Service (Enhanced) certificate or Access NI certificate (obtained within the last 12 months), including both child and adult barring lists (or be prepared to obtain) with annual updates
  • Excellent knowledge of the Highway Code and the ability to refer to the Highway Code during courses.
  • The ability to deliver training courses as specified in the course manual, and commitment to doing so.
  • The willingness to adapt delivery style to meet the needs of diverse groups of clients.
  • Excellent presentation skills.
  • Excellent group facilitation skills.
  • Excellent coaching skills.
